A Fragile Enchantment by Allison Saft

2.0

This is a fantasy romance set in regency England. Alas, I didn't love the romance parts, and I have some problems with the Regency parts.

This book is utterly lacking the feeling of being a historical romance. There is no charm of the regency period. The book fully embraces modern ways of speech and manners, and the regency period culture only pops up occasionally. The rules of the period typically only pop up in order to be dismissed by the characters as something that they're not going to do.

I never felt the chemistry of the romance. It fell very flat.

There is a larger political plot. The Irish-coded people living in London are protesting the working conditions. It was very boring. Though the plot was constantly brought up, it never really affected the protagonist's plot.
